Aaron Rodgers opened his final NFL season with a win, but it was T.J. Watt who stole the show in a 20-to-13 victory over the Falcons Sunday at Acrisure Stadium. Watt returned an interception 35 yards for a touchdown, added two sacks and three tackles for loss, and completely took over the fourth quarter.
Rodgers threw for 221 yards and a touchdown, connecting with Pat Freiermuth for a 6-yard score, and it’s the Steelers’ third straight season-opening win. Atlanta’s Bijan Robinson was excellent in defeat — 83 rushing yards plus eight catches for 90 yards and a touchdown — but two Cooper Rush interceptions, including Watt’s pick-six, proved decisive.
The Steelers improve to 1-and-0 and host Seattle next Sunday.
